Reflexive pronouns play a vital role in the English language, serving to reflect the action of a verb back onto the subject. These pronouns, such as ‘myself,’ ‘yourself,’ ‘himself,’ ‘herself,’ ‘itself,’ ‘ourselves,’ ‘yourselves,’ and ‘themselves,’ are used to convey actions or experiences that individuals or objects perform upon themselves.
